South Valley Assisted Living in Draper, UT is a warm and inviting community that offers a range of care options to meet the individual needs of our residents. Our community provides both board and care home services as well as skilled nursing facility care, ensuring that each resident receives the appropriate level of support.
Our amenities are designed to enhance the quality of life for our residents. We have a spacious dining room where delicious meals are served, ensuring that special dietary restrictions are accommodated. The living spaces are fully furnished, providing a comfortable and home-like environment. Residents can also enjoy the outdoor space and garden, perfect for relaxation or socializing with friends.
At South Valley Assisted Living, we understand the importance of maintaining a clean and organized living environment. Our dedicated housekeeping services ensure that residents' rooms and common areas are always tidy and neat.
We also provide assistance with various activ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. Our highly trained staff works closely with health care providers to coordinate medical care for our residents, ensuring their well-being is prioritized at all times. Medication management is offered to ensure that medications are taken correctly and on time.
Transportation arrangements can be made for medical appointments or any other necessary outings. Additionally, our community is conveniently located near par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, and theaters, providing easy access to essential services and entertainment options.
To enrich the lives of our residents further, we offer scheduled daily activities designed to promote physical fitness, mental stimulation, social interaction, and overall well-being.
South Valley Assisted Living in Draper takes pride in providing exemplary care while fostering a supportive and engaging environment for our residents.

Assisted living costs often exceed Social Security benefits, necessitating a combination of funding sources like state aid and Medicaid. Understanding the interaction between Social Security programs and available financial support is essential for affording such care.
The VA Aid and Attendance benefit provides financial support to veterans needing assistance with daily living due to medical conditions or disabilities, augmenting standard VA pensions for services like in-home care. Eligibility is based on service duration, wartime status, income, and medical needs, with a detailed application process required to access funds for caregiving and home modifications.
Senior move management services assist older adults in the relocation process by providing emotional support and organizational help, addressing unique challenges like downsizing and moving from long-term homes. These specialists collaborate with real estate agents and manage logistics, making the transition smoother for seniors and their families.
